Women's Equestrian Opening Weekend Results

Reedley College opened the 2019-20 women's equestrian season last weekend by winning Reserve High Point team honors at the College of the Sequoias Tulare campus.

"Saturday was a great day with several wins," reported RC coach Desi Molyneux.

Makalia Nowell took first place in the Rookie A division. Jessie Miles (Minarets) was Reserve High Point Rider after second-place finishes in Reining and Open Horsemanship.

On Sunday, the Reedley College Home Show was held at the COS campus. "This was another great day with many winners and great attendance from the Reedley College campus community," said the coach.

Miles was named the High Point Rider after first-place finishes in Reining and Open Horsemanship.

Macey Stowers took first place in Level One Western Horsemanship while Nowell again took first place in Rookie A.
